Harriet wants to buy items worth $248.50. She is using a store coupon for 25 percent off her purchases. She has to pay 5 percent sales tax. Calculate the total cost of the items.

Starting price is : $248.50
Price with 25% off :
$248.50 x ( 1 - 0.25 ) = $248.50 x 0.75 = $186.375
After that she has to pay 5 % sales tax:
$186.375 x 1.05 = $195.70
Answer:
The total cost of the items is $195.70.
